Asphere of radius 3 inches is sliced with two parallel planes: one passes through the equator and the other is h inches above the first plane. the resulting portion of the sphere between the two planes is called a spherical segment; see the picture: in math 125, you will show that the volume v of the spherical segment is given by this formula (which we will assume): v = (π/3)h(27 – h2). give exact answers to the questions below. (a) find the volume of the spherical segment if h=1: (b) find the rate of change of the volume with respect to h of the spherical segment at h=1: (c) use the tangent line approximation at h=1 to estimate the value of h that will yield a spherical segment having volume 25 cubic inches:
